Identifying slope from a graph represents a fundamental skill in algebra that bridges visual representation with mathematical understanding. These interactive videos guide students through the process of determining slope by examining the rise and run between points on a linear graph, while embedded comprehension checks ensure students can distinguish between positive, negative, zero, and undefined slopes. Through guided video lessons with real-time feedback, students develop the ability to calculate slope using coordinate points, interpret slope as a rate of change, and connect graphical representations to algebraic concepts.
